Regardless which injector that I've ran, my fuel mileage remains the same. If you want the best fuel mileage, you may want to consider a twin set-up. Thats sounds off based but you wont need as much throttle to move the truck, this saves fuel. The turbos will spool-up faster and get the truck up to highway speeds with less throttle (smoke). I don't see any fuel mileage saving by running the .75 mach's. Your motor only needs so much fuel to push the truck at highway speeds. If your running mach 6er's or mach 1's, its still the same amount of fuel. This of course you have to use the same throttle position. With my truck I've only seen fuel mileage improvements with each step change that I've done with the truck, but its a rare day that I get 20+mpg based on us gallons. There more to fuel mileage than just the injectors. A stock truck get around 16-18mpg, if I get around 18-20mpg now, you can buy lots of parts on the money that you've saved on fuel.
